EVALUATION OF CHARGED CURRENT NEUTRINO–NUCLEON INTERACTION CROSS-SECTION
Abstract
The charged current neutrino–nucleon interaction cross-section is evaluated using Thermodynamical Bag Model (TBM) in the neutrino energy range 1 < Eν < 200 GeV with the value of the four-momentum transfer squared 0.1 < Q2 < 20 GeV2 and the Bjorken variable 0.1 < x < 0.5. The hadronic current carries the linear moments of the reaction that depend on the Bjorken scaling variable x as well as the four-momentum transfer. The results obtained have been compared with the experimental values.
